Recipient Checks
Use this section to prevent directory-harvest attacks and attacks that issue large numbers of email
messages (known as flooding). You can provide the appliance with a list of permitted recipients. Your
network might already have this information on its LDAP servers. Alternatively, you can import a list of
email addresses from a text file.
Table 72 Option definitions
Option
Definition
Protocol preset
Specifies the policy (and network group) to which these settings apply.
If the recipient is not in
the following list
When selected, checks the recipient address against email addresses in the list.
Email address
Lists the acceptable email addresses. You can use wildcards, for example:
user*@example.com. We recommend that you do not overuse wildcards,
because you will defeat the intention.
Or if the recipient is not
listed in LDAP
When selected, checks the recipient address against email addresses in the
LDAP. To connect to an LDAP server, select
System
|
Users, Groups and Services
|
Directory Services
on the navigation bar.
Take the following action
•
Accept and ignore the recipient
— Accepts the email message and ignores it. The
appliance sends an acceptance code (SMTP 250 OK). We do not recommend
this option because it suggests to the sender that the message was received
as intended.
•
Reject
— Sends a rejection code (SMTP 550 Fail). We recommend this option
because the sender is normally informed that the message was not accepted.
Directory harvest prevention
Use this section to prevent directory harvest attacks. The appliance examines the number of known
and unknown email addresses to determine whether an attack is taking place.
When used with some email servers, Directory Harvest Prevention might
not function as expected.
Table 73 Option definitions
Option
Definition
Protocol preset
Specifies the policy (and network group) to which these settings apply.
When the appliance is in
transparent mode
•
None
— Takes no action.
•
Tarpit
— Delays a response to email that has several recipient addresses.
•
Tarpit then deny connection
— Delays a response to the email, then adds the
sender to the Denied Connections list.
•
Deny connection
— Adds the sender to the Denied Connections list.
Default value is
Deny connection
.
When the appliance is in
proxy mode
•
None
— takes no action.
•
Deny connection
— adds the sender to the Denied Connections list.
Default value is
Deny connection
.
